Understanding Your Sofa’s Materials: The Foundation of Care
Before diving into specific care techniques, it’s crucial to know what your Santa Monica sofa is made of. Bernhardt offers various upholstery options, and each has its own unique needs. Are you working with a natural fiber like cotton or linen? Perhaps a durable synthetic blend, or maybe even luxurious leather? Checking the manufacturer’s care tag or your original purchase documentation is your first, and most important, step. For instance, natural fibers might be more susceptible to fading from direct sunlight, while certain synthetics could be sensitive to harsh chemicals. Leather, of course, requires its own specialized conditioning. Knowing these basics sets the stage for effective and safe cleaning and maintenance. Daily Habits for a Pristine Sofa
Little and often is the mantra here. Simple daily or weekly practices can make a world of difference in preserving your Bernhardt Santa Monica sofa’s appearance and integrity.
- Regular Vacuuming: This is your secret weapon against dust, crumbs, and pet hair. Use the upholstery attachment on your vacuum cleaner. Get into all the nooks and crannies – under the cushions, along the seams, and down the sides. This prevents abrasive particles from settling into the fabric and causing premature wear.
- Fluff and Rotate Cushions: If your sofa has removable cushions, give them a good fluff and rotate them regularly. This ensures even wear and helps them keep their shape. Imagine rotating your tires on a car; it distributes the stress evenly.
- Address Spills Immediately: Accidents happen. Blot, don’t rub, any spills as soon as they occur. Use a clean, white cloth and work from the outside of the spill inward. Rubbing can spread the stain and damage the upholstery fibers. For most fabrics, a gentle blotting with a slightly damp cloth is the way to go. For leather, specific leather cleaners might be necessary.
- Sunlight Savvy: While natural light is lovely, prolonged exposure to direct sunlight can fade upholstery colors over time. Consider using blinds or curtains during the sunniest parts of the day, especially if your sofa is near a window. It’s a simple way to protect its vibrant appearance.
Deep Cleaning and Stain Removal: When Life Happens
Sometimes, a quick vacuum isn’t enough. When deeper cleaning or stain removal is needed, proceed with caution and always test any cleaning solution in an inconspicuous area first. This is non-negotiable.
- Fabric Upholstery: For water-soluble stains (like juice or coffee), a mild solution of dish soap and water can often work wonders. Mix a tiny amount of clear dish soap with distilled water and apply with a clean cloth, blotting gently. Avoid oversaturating the fabric. For tougher stains or if you’re unsure, a reputable upholstery cleaner designed for your specific fabric type is your best bet. Always follow the product instructions carefully.
- Leather Upholstery: Leather requires specialized care. Use a dedicated leather cleaner to remove dirt and grime, and follow up with a leather conditioner every 6-12 months. Conditioning keeps the leather supple and prevents it from drying out and cracking. Think of it like moisturizing your skin; it keeps it healthy and elastic.
- Spot Cleaning: For most minor spots, a damp cloth followed by a dry cloth usually suffices. Remember the blotting technique. Patience is key here; you don’t want to create a bigger problem than you’re solving.
Protecting Your Investment: Beyond Cleaning
Longevity isn’t just about cleaning; it’s also about proactive protection. Little measures can go a long way in safeguarding your Bernhardt Santa Monica sofa from everyday wear and tear.
- Consider Slipcovers or Throws: For high-traffic areas or if you have pets or young children, high-quality slipcovers or strategically placed throws can offer an extra layer of protection. They are much easier to clean or replace than the sofa’s primary upholstery.
- Pest Prevention: Keep your home clean to deter common household pests that might be attracted to natural fibers. Regular vacuuming helps with this too.
-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Never use bleach or abrasive cleaners on your upholstery. These can strip color, damage fibers, and permanently alter the look and feel of your sofa. Stick to pH-neutral cleaners or those specifically recommended for your fabric type. It’s always better to be safe than sorry.
Troubleshooting Common Sofa Issues
Even with the best care, you might encounter a few common issues. Here’s how to tackle them:
- Fading: As mentioned, sunlight is a primary culprit. Rotating furniture and using window treatments are your best defense. If fading has already occurred, there isn’t much you can do to reverse it, but keeping the rest of the sofa clean can make the difference less noticeable.
- Pilling (Fabric Sofas): Small balls of fiber can form on the surface of some fabrics. You can often remove these gently with a fabric shaver or by carefully trimming them with small scissors. Be very careful not to cut the underlying fabric.
- Scratches (Leather Sofas): Minor scratches on leather can sometimes be buffed out with a soft cloth or a leather conditioner. For deeper scratches, professional repair might be the best option.
When to Call in the Professionals
While most routine care can be handled at home, there are times when calling in the experts is the wisest choice. If you’re dealing with a large, stubborn stain, or if your sofa has delicate upholstery that you’re hesitant to clean yourself, professional upholstery cleaning services are invaluable. They have specialized equipment and knowledge to tackle challenging situations without damaging your furniture. Don’t hesitate to seek professional help for deep cleaning, odor removal, or significant stain treatment.
